Section two: Object
two.1) Scope of the procurement
two.1.1) Title
Holidays, Activities and Food (HAF) services DPS (SC240025)
Reference number
DN717964
two.1.2) Main CPV code
- 85000000 - Health and social work services
two.1.3) Type of contract
Services
two.1.4) Short description
Kent County Council is establishing a Dynamic Purchasing System (DPS) for the provision of the Holiday Activities and Food (HAF) programme. The HAF programme aims to provide healthy food and enriching activities for children and young people during school holidays. The DPS will be divided into geographical lots covering North, East, South, and West Kent, with opportunities for providers to bid for specific districts or parishes. The programme targets children aged 4-16 who are eligible for benefits-related Free School Meals (FSM).
